Love in Translation
Discover the captivating journey of self-discovery in Love in Translation by Wendy Tokunaga. Published by Griffin Publishing in 2009, this engaging novel spans 272 pages and delves into the life of 33-year-old aspiring singer Celeste Duncan. Feeling trapped in a stagnant career and a deadbeat relationship, Celeste's world takes a turn when she receives an unexpected phone call and a box filled with enigmatic family heirlooms. These treasures may hold the key to uncovering the identity of her long-lost father. As Celeste navigates the complexities of her past, she embarks on a profound journey of self-realization and family secrets, all set against the backdrop of her experiences in Japan.
